## Draft context (2026-08-10 /align interview; amended same-day review round)
Skill spec, from the recorded requirement and the review-round resolutions:
- One iteration per invocation; attended, author-invoked, never cron
(strategy condition 9).
- Serialization: claim the strategy-recursive-self-improvement worktree
(worktree-as-claim, the router's liveness rule) at invocation; fail closed
with a printed error when the claim is held. No second detection mechanism.
- Iteration flow:
1. Subagent /rsi-plan renders: run render-rsi-plan.ts, draft the three queue
summaries (landed as dated readings on strategy-graph-native-dispatch,
strategy-attention-surface, strategy-recursive-self-improvement), flag
mechanical staleness (done tasks, breached thresholds).
2. Main-thread judgment (this skill, never the subagent): what graph updates
are required; harness vs rsi-shortcut routing per item; whether an /align
session is needed for author input; task-plan revision.
3. Optional /align escalation for findings unresolvable from recorded
guidance.
4. Either draft tactics for harness optimization (3a) or execute rsi-plan
tasks to budget (3b). Budget: default 1; rsi-implement tasks cost 1;
others 0 unless declared.
- rsi-implement is a loop inside this skill (see tactic-rsi-implement-skill).
- Pause/resume: through the doctrinal mechanism (dispatch.config boolean once
tactic-dispatch-pause-config-field lands; sentinel interim); resume criteria
recorded as structured, mechanically evaluable data rendered into
rsi-plan.md.
- Evaluation scope each iteration: bugs inconsistent with documented
intention; execution inefficiencies (token waste from poorly managed
context, unoptimized model choice, redundant work, repeated errors);
ambiguities in author intention (e.g. parked office-hours nodes on the
critical path); technical debt not justified by current greenfield design.
- Fitness function (strategy clarification 10): value delivered by the
combined dispatch + office-hours + rsi system toward author intentions —
closure velocity + signal progress per token, attributed per workflow;
dispatch expected to dominate spend.
- rsi is not a graph executor — planning and critical-path shortcutting only.
